COURSE CONTENT AND STRUCTURE

Morning

• Definition of Lasers

• Laser Physics

• Classification of Lasers

• The difference between IPL and Laser Machines

• How to choose the right Laser for both medical and hair removal

• Registering your clinic

• Maintaining correct paperwork

• Anatomy of the hair and skin

• Causes and pathological reasons for extra hair growth

• Hormonal effects on hair growth patterns

• Hair Growth cycle

• Skin typing – Fitzpatrick Scale

• Hair type and pre-treatment consideration affecting treatment

• Client consultation and communication including detailed investigative techniques

• Consent forms

• Medical contra-indication that prevent or restrict treatment

• Medical history

• Medical referral protocols to G.P.

• Patch testing client before treatment

• Drugs and other remedies that can affect treatment

• Aftercare and homecare advice

• Treatment protocols

• Consultation forms – completion of recording data relating to treatment – changes of medication, areas treated, machine settings used including shots fired, evaluation after treatment

• Costs of treatment

• Conditions that can be treated

• Effectiveness of treatments

• Length of time between treatments

• Adverse reactions and how to deal with them

• Machine settings for treatments

• Client sensation that they will fe4el during treatment
